也一直使用vim进行开发工作,但是一直都没找到比较靠谱的vimrc的配置。今天google了一下,找到了前辈留下的vimrc的配置,自己也测试了一把,效果甚好。
插件使用vundle插件管理器,现把步骤写下来,做个备忘。

超强vim配置文件

Build Status

运行截图

图片描述

简易安装方法:

打开终端,执行下面的命令就自动安装好了:

wget -qO- https://raw.github.com/ma6174/vim/master/setup.sh | sh -x

或者自己手动安装:(以ubuntu为例)

  1. 安装vim sudo apt-get install vim

  • 安装ctags:sudo apt-get install ctags

  • 安装一些必备程序:sudo apt-get install xclip vim-gnome astyle python-setuptools

  • python代码格式化工具:sudo easy_install -ZU autopep8

  • sudo ln -s /usr/bin/ctags /usr/local/bin/ctags

  • clone配置文件:cd ~/ && git clone git://github.com/ma6174/vim.git

  • mv ~/vim ~/.vim

  • mv ~/.vim/.vimrc ~/

  • clone bundle 程序:git clone https://github.com/gmarik/vundle.git ~/.vim/bundle/vundle

  • 打开vim并执行bundle程序:BundleInstall

  • 重新打开vim即可看到效果

了解更多vim使用的小技巧:

vim 使用tip

编写python程序

  1. 自动插入头信息:

    • #!/usr/bin/env python

    • # coding=utf-8

  • 输入.或按TAB键会触发代码补全功能

  • :w保存代码之后会自动检查代码错误与规范

  • F6可以按pep8格式对代码格式优化

  • F5可以一键执行代码

多窗口操作

  1. 使用:sp + 文件名可以水平分割窗口

  • 使用:vs + 文件名可以垂直分割窗口

  • 使用Ctrl + w可以快速在窗口间切换

编写markdown文件

  1. 编写markdown文件(*.md)的时候,在normal模式下按 md 即可在当前目录下生成相应的html文件

  • 生成之后还是在normal模式按fi可以使用firefox打开相应的html文件预览

  • 当然也可以使用万能的F5键来一键转换并打开预览

  • 如果打开过程中屏幕出现一些混乱信息,可以按Ctrl + l来恢复

快速注释

  • \ 可以根据文件类型自动注释


tomato
309 声望19 粉丝

1个在coding路上越走越迷茫的coder